CHICAGO (WLS) — Charges have been filed Friday in the accidental shooting of a 3-year old boy.

Police said Milton Scott was trying to holster his gun inside an Austin home in the 100-block of North Latrobe Thursday night when the gun went off, hitting the boy in the shin.

He was taken by ambulance to Stroger Hospital in good condition, Chicago police said.

Scott is facing multiple charges, including reckless conduct and child endangerment.
